Once Upon A Nuclear Ship - Stories of the NS Savannah is a documentary film that was released in 2012. The movie revolves around the story of the NS Savannah, which was the world's first nuclear-powered cargo and passenger ship. The documentary details the history of the ship from its inception, construction, launch, and eventual decommission, and offers an inside look into the world of nuclear-powered ships.
